Why Are So Many Writers Dropping Out Of Adelaide’s Famous Writing Festival?

“Nearly 50 authors, commentators, and academics have dropped out of this year’s Adelaide Festival in Australia after the Festival announced that they were canceling an appearance by Dr. Randa Abdel-Fattah over ‘cultural sensitivity’ concerns.” - LitHub

DorkSearchPRO: Google Dorks Generator

“Advanced Passive Reconnaissance Tool for OSINT & Security Research. Generate powerful Google Dorks instantly • 100% Client-Side • Open Source. Google Dorking (also known as Google Hacking) is an OSINT technique that uses advanced search operators to uncover security vulnerabilities, exposed sensitive files, and misconfigurations in web servers and applications. 

Security researchers, penetration testers, and cybersecurity professionals use Google Dorks to perform passive reconnaissance and identify potential attack vectors before malicious actors do.

  •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) – Google Dorks are advanced search operators that allow security researchers and penetration testers to discover information exposed on the internet that isn’t easily accessible through standard searches. They use special commands like filetype:inurl:site:, and intitle: to filter Google results and find sensitive files, admin panels, configuration files, and potential security vulnerabilities.
